Seleukeia Sidera (AD 268-270) AE 33 - Claudius II

Claudius II Gothicus, 268-270 AD. AE33 (17.76g). AV K M AVP KΛAVΔIOC, laureate and cuirassed bust right / KΛAVΔIOCЄΛЄVKЄΩN, Tyche with rudder and cornucopiae. Rare. Dark green patina, VF.
